Client Solutions Associate Salary in Hanover, MD

How much does a Client Solutions Associate make in Hanover, MD?

As of August 01, 2026, the average salary for a Client Solutions Associate in Hanover, MD is $44,045 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$21.

However, a Client Solutions Associate's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$52,678
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$39,816 to $48,564
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$35,966

How Experience Level Affects Client Solutions Associate Salaries?

Experience is a primary driver of a Client Solutions Associate's salary. As you build your skills and take on more complex tasks, your compensation generally increases. Here’s how the average salary grows at different career stages:

  • Entry-Level (less than 1 year): $39,304
  • Early Career (1-2 years): $44,338
  • Mid-Level (2-4 years): $51,916
  • Senior-Level (5-8 years): $58,013
  • Expert (over 8 years): $65,058

Client Solutions Associate Salary by Industry: Top Paying Sectors

For Client Solutions Associate roles, the industry you choose can affect earning potential by as much as 30% (the gap between the highest and lowest paying industries). Data shows that the Financial Services and Biotechnology sectors offer the strongest compensation, at 15% above the average. In contrast, Client Solutions Associate positions in Edu., Gov't. & Nonprofit or Transportation typically offer lower base pay, as these industries often view Client Solutions Associate as a support function rather than a direct revenue driver.
